Imports Microsoft.VisualBasic.Language.Python
Namespace ComponentModel.Algorithm.DynamicProgramming
''' <summary>
''' Longest Common Subsequence
''' </summary>
Public Class LongestCommonSubsequence(Of T)
Public Property length As Integer
Public Property si As Integer
Public Property ti As Integer
Public Property reversed As Boolean
Dim a As T()
Dim b As T()
Public ReadOnly Property Sequence() As T()
Get
If length >= 0 Then
Return a.slice(si, si + length)
Else
Return {}
End If
End Get
End Property
Sub New(s As T(), t As T(), equals As IEquals(Of T))
Dim mf = findMatch(s, t, equals)
Dim tr = t.slice(0).Reverse().ToArray
Dim mr = findMatch(s, tr, equals)
If (mf(0) >= mr(0)) Then
length = mf(0)
si = mf(1)
ti = mf(2)
reversed = False
Else
length = mr(0)
si = mr(1)
ti = t.Length - mr(2) - mr(0)
reversed = True
End If
End Sub
''' <summary>
'''
''' </summary>
''' <param name="s"></param>
''' <param name="t"></param>
''' <param name="equals"></param>
''' <returns>``{length, si, ti}``</returns>
Private Shared Function findMatch(s As T(), t As T(), equals As IEquals(Of T)) As Integer()
Dim m = s.Length
Dim n = t.Length
Dim match = {0, -1, -1}
Dim l = New Integer(m - 1)() {}
For i As Integer = 0 To m - 1
l(i) = New Integer(n - 1) {}
For j As Integer = 0 To n - 1
If equals(s(i), t(j)) Then
Dim v = If(i = 0 OrElse j = 0, 1, l(i - 1)(j - 1) + 1)
l(i)(j) = v
If (v > match.Length) Then
match(0) = v
match(1) = i - v + 1
match(2) = j - v + 1
End If
Else
l(i)(j) = 0
End If
Next
Next
Return match
End Function
End Class
End Namespace
